Battery Care Tips
Battery Care Tips
🔹 Getting Started
Charge your new battery fully before you use it for the first time. Over the next few charge cycles, run your device down to around 20% before you recharge—this helps the battery perform its best. After that, charge whenever you need to.
🔹 Keep It Healthy
Avoid letting your battery completely drain or staying plugged in constantly. Both extremes wear it out faster. Store the battery in a cool, dry place when you're not using it, since heat damages batteries quickly.

JAY-tech JayCam i6550 / Z630 — 3.7V Li-ion Replacement Battery
This 3.7V Li-ion battery replaces the original cell in the JAY-tech JayCam i6550 and JayCam Z630 compact digital cameras. Capacity is 850mAh (3.15Wh), matching the stock specification. It fits the same battery bay and connector as the original without modification.
- JayCam i6550 and Z630 compatibility: Both models share the same battery bay dimensions (40.20 × 35.30 × 6.10mm), voltage rail, and connector orientation — one cell covers both bodies.
- Bench tested on actual hardware: We ran this cell through charge and discharge cycles on the bench. The BMS held the 3.7V nominal rail steady across the discharge curve, with cutoff triggering cleanly before voltage collapsed.
- First-use charge cycle on the JayCam body: After inserting this cell for the first time, run a full charge via the camera body or OEM charger before shooting. Some compact camera BMS systems need that first in-body charge cycle to map the new cell's discharge curve and report battery-remaining accurately.
Battery percentage jumping erratically on the JayCam display
The JayCam i6550 maps its battery indicator against voltage thresholds calibrated to the original cell's discharge curve. A new replacement cell may discharge slightly differently across that curve, causing the indicator to read 80% then jump to 40% with no warning. This is a display calibration issue, not a fault with the cell. Run one full charge-to-discharge cycle through the camera body and the indicator typically stabilises as the BMS recalibrates its threshold mapping.
Camera showing dead battery indicator on a partially charged replacement cell
If the JayCam body shows a dead or critically low battery symbol immediately after inserting a new cell, the BMS is reading resting voltage below its acceptance threshold — this can happen when a replacement cell has self-discharged in storage. Place the cell in the OEM charger until the charge indicator confirms a full charge, then reinsert. If the camera still rejects it, check the cell is seated fully against the connector — the i6550 bay requires firm pressure until the latch clicks. A fully charged cell should read at or above 4.1V at the terminals.

Frequently Asked Questions
My JayCam i6550 says "No Battery" even though the replacement is fully charged — what's wrong?
The i6550 performs a voltage-handshake check on insertion. If the cell rested in storage for a while, its open-circuit voltage may have dropped just below the camera's acceptance threshold even after a partial charge. Charge the cell to full in the OEM charger first, then insert it — the camera needs to see a voltage at or above 4.1V to pass that check. If the message persists, reseat the battery firmly until the bay latch clicks.
My shot count on the JayCam Z630 is noticeably lower than expected — is the cell faulty?
Shot count estimates assume light continuous use, but flash recycling on the Z630 draws a surge of current each cycle that adds significantly to total drain beyond the spec figure. Continuous autofocus, optical zoom motor movement, and LCD brightness all compound that draw further. The 850mAh capacity is correct — the shot count simply reflects real-world draw across all active subsystems, not flash-off static capture. Turn off the LCD review delay and reduce flash use to stretch capacity between charges.
The flash on my JayCam i6550 isn't fully recycling between shots — takes much longer than it used to. Why?
Flash recycling pulls a high burst of current to charge the capacitor, and that recharge time lengthens as cell voltage sags toward the lower end of the discharge curve. On the i6550, if you're seeing slow recycle times, the cell is likely near cutoff — check the battery indicator and recharge before continuing. If this happens early in a fresh charge, confirm the battery contacts in the bay are clean and making firm contact, as even slight resistance adds to capacitor recharge lag.
